1) Describe how you might contribute to a lesson given to a group of seven year old children learning to play percussion instruments.
My first contribution to the lesson would be to prepare the instruments outlined in the lesson plan, ensuring that they were available for use on that day. I would then check the condition of the instruments, ensuring they were in good working order and clean. It is important that I make myself aware of any policy and procedures in place within the school for using percussion instruments and where possible refer to manufactures guidelines for appropriate use of the equipment and any recommendations.
It is then important that I familiarise myself with the learning objectives of the lesson plan and prepare the classroom to best meet these objectives, taking into account health and safety regulations, by ensuring there is safe access both in and out of the classroom, and that the pupils can move about the room safely. It is also important that I take into account that the pupils can use the instruments in a safe manner without any obstructions, ensuring there is enough space between each instrument.
During the actual lesson I can contribute by providing assistance to pupils who may not have understood the teacher’s guidelines. I may need to repeat the instructions in a different manner or to demonstrate what the teacher has asked. It is important that I re-enforce what the teacher has instructed. Other assistance that I may need to provide is to show each student how to use the instruments in a safe and correct manner.
Supervising the students whilst using the instruments is part of the contribution I would make to the lesson ensuring all pupils use equipment appropriately throughout the lesson, and ensuring that if their concentration appears to be slipping to add a new fun aspect to what they’re doing, providing praise and encouragement would help to ensure the pupils actively participate in the lesson.
Observing the pupils and assisting those who appear to be struggling is also part of the contribution I would make, any observation I make would be discussed with the teacher when appropriate so that if a pupil is struggling then it can be addressed by the teacher in a appropriate manner that does not single out the pupil from the rest of the class. My observation help to monitor the pupils ability and progress, to assist the teacher in providing the right level of stimulus to the pupil in any future lessons, for example if one pupil is showing to excel at percussion a higher level of goal to achieve may be required to maintain there interest in future lessons.
I would also contribute by helping to address any negative behaviour in an appropriate and calm manner, ensuring the teacher is aware of any behavioural issues.
At the end of the lesson I should provide the teacher with any feedback. I should ensure that each child feels as though they have accomplished something within the lesson and praise them for their efforts and achievements.
Once all pupils have left the room all musical instruments should be returned to resources, before returning I need to check all equipment is present, clean and in good working order any damages should be reported. Once all equipment has been returned it is important to ensure that the classroom is returned to its original condition and not left unsafe or disorderly.
2) What might your role be in organising, using and maintaining the learning resources, material and equipment for this percussion lesson'
Prior to the lesson I would ensure that any equipment outlined in the lesson plan was available for that day, preferably this is to be done a couple of days prior and where necessary book the equipment for use on the day the lesson is to be carried out. This helps to ensure that all equipment necessary is available and not being used by another class, feedback should then be given to the teacher as to whether that equipment is available for the day intended so that other arrangements can be made in necessary.
Before the lesson starts I would retrieve all the necessary equipment including worksheets and instruments, ensuring there is enough for each child to use and that the instruments required for the lesson according to the lesson plan are provided.
I would check all the equipment to ensure it is in compliance with health and safety policy, is clean and hygienic and is appropriate for the pupils to use, for example the size of the instrument is appropriate for the pupils.
An inventory of all equipment should be properly maintained, all instruments being used should be logged out and the condition they are in noted. Any problems with the equipment should be noted in a maintenance log. If I am able to I should carry out any repairs necessary, however if repairs are out of my capability then it is vital I do not attempt to repair them as I could compromise the safety of the equipment. Once all resources have been attained I should place them safely within the classroom allowing enough space for safe use and easy access. It is important that I follow the guidelines of the teacher in the positioning of each instrument.
Whilst the lesson is in progress it is important that I monitor how the equipment is being used, to ensure that it is used in accordance with guidelines and to prevent any damage from occurring and where necessary provide guidance to the pupils for correct and safe use.
Once the lesson is complete it is important that all materials are returned to the correct place, so they can be accessed by others. On returning each item I should check them against the inventory list to ensure they have all been returned. I should also ensure they have been returned clean and are safe for use by the next class. I should carry out any repairs necessary and note down any repairs that are out of my capability to fix, and report this to the teacher along with any missing items.
